A CHIPPENDALE CARVED WALNUT DRESSING TABLE Philadelphia, 1750-1760 The rectangular molded top above a conforming case fitted with a thumbmolded long drawer over three thumbmolded short drawers, the central drawer enlarged and embellished with a carved recessed shell issuing an applied scrolling leaves, flanked by reeded quarter columns above a shaped skirt centered by a relief-carved shell, on shell-carved cabriole legs with ball-and-claw feet, appears to retain original brasses, replaced escutcheon plate 30in. high, 37in. wide, 19in. deep
